

Frances (Fran) Hamilton Davidson passed away peacefully on March 21, 2026, at the age of 96 in Fort Myers, Florida. She was born on November 16, 1929, in Charleston, West Virginia, to Jean and Eustace Chilton and was a graduate of South Charleston High School.
Fran married G. Clark Davidson of St. Albans, West Virginia, and together they built a life and raised two children. Frances spent much of her career in the fashion industry, working as a buyer for several upscale women’s clothing stores in Charleston. She also served as the office manager for her husband’s residential construction company.
In 1992, Fran and Clark moved from West Virginia to Florida, where she enjoyed traveling and a relaxed coastal lifestyle of boating, golfing, and spending time with her family.
Fran was preceded in death by her husband. She is lovingly remembered by her son, Giles Davidson, and his husband, Dan Waldmann, of Pittsburgh; daughter, Gina Jensen, and her husband, John Jensen, of Fort Myers; and grandson, Johnny Jensen, a recent graduate of the Berklee College of Music in Boston.
A celebration of life will be held in the future.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Cafe Momentum Pittsburgh, The Gulf Coast Humane Society, or The Harry Chapin Food Bank of SW Florida.
